
Officially: Monaco Announces the Signing of Ansu Fati on Loan
Monaco Football Club has announced, via its official website, its signing of Spanish star Ansu Fati, coming from Barcelona, on loan for the 2025/2026 season, with an option to buy.
The club expressed its happiness in acquiring the player, confirming that Fati, who is 22 years old, will enhance the team's attacking options during the upcoming season in Ligue 1.
The statement from the French club highlighted the player's key moments, noting that he played 123 matches with Barcelona, scoring 29 goals and providing 8 assists, and won several domestic titles such as La Liga, the Copa del Rey, and the Spanish Super Cup, while also becoming the youngest goalscorer in the history of the UEFA Champions League.
The club added that Fati spent the 2023/2024 season on loan at Brighton in the Premier League, participating in 27 matches and scoring 4 goals, in addition to representing Spain in the 2022 World Cup and winning the UEFA Nations League title in 2023.
